Definition of Lister
1. Noun. English surgeon who was the first to use antiseptics (1827-1912).
2. Noun. Assessor who makes out the tax lists.
3. Noun. Moldboard plow with a double moldboard designed to move dirt to either side of a central furrow.
Exact synonyms: Lister Plough, Lister Plow, Middle Buster, Middlebreaker

Definition of Lister
1. n. One who makes a list or roll.
2. n. Same as Leister.
3. n. A double-moldboard plow which throws a deep furrow, and at the same time plants and covers grain in the bottom of the furrow.
